MUMBAI, India, July 31 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202411096066 A) filed by Lovely Professional University on December 05, 2024, for Therapeutic Method Using Carnosic Acid For Lead-Induced Kidney Damage Mitigation.

Abstract: The present invention relates to a therapeutic method for mitigating lead-induced kidney damage using carnosic acid, specifically in the field of nephroprotection and oxidative stress management. The method involves administering carnosic acid in a dual-dose regimen of 25 mg/kg and 50 mg/kg, once daily for 14 days, to subjects such as Swiss albino mice, which have been induced with nephrotoxicity via intraperitoneal administration of lead acetate. The therapeutic efficacy is assessed by measuring biochemical markers of kidney function, including blood urea nitrogen (BUN) and serum creatinine, alongside evaluating oxidative stress markers and apoptosis-related proteins in renal tissues. The carnosic acid activates the NRF2 pathway, resulting in the upregulation of antioxidant enzymes like superoxide dismutase (SOD) and glutathione peroxidase (GSH-Px), thereby elucidating its protective mechanisms. The method includes histopathological analysis of kidney tissues and dose-dependent comparison, revealing the effects of lead-induced nephrotoxicity and the protective role of carnosic acid.
